LLM za preverjanje zasnove strojne opreme

LLM za preverjanje zasnove strojne opreme

Izvorno vozlišče: 2939691

Raziskovalci na Univerzi v Cambridgeu, lowRISC in Imperial College London so objavili tehnični dokument z naslovom "LLM4DV: Uporaba velikih jezikovnih modelov za generiranje dražljajev za testiranje strojne opreme".

Povzetek:

»Generacija testnih dražljajev je bila ključna, a delovno intenzivna naloga pri preverjanju zasnove strojne opreme. V tem prispevku revolucioniramo ta proces z izkoriščanjem moči velikih jezikovnih modelov (LLM) in predstavljamo nov okvir primerjalne analize, LLM4DV. To ogrodje uvaja prompt predlogo za interaktivno pridobivanje preskusnih dražljajev iz LLM, skupaj s štirimi inovativnimi spodbudnimi izboljšavami za podporo izvajanja cevovoda in nadaljnje izboljšanje njegove učinkovitosti. LLM4DV primerjamo s tradicionalnim omejenim naključnim testiranjem (CRT) z uporabo treh samozasnovanih modulov načrtovanja v testiranju (DUT). Poskusi dokazujejo, da je LLM4DV odličen pri učinkovitem obravnavanju enostavnih scenarijev DUT, pri čemer izkorišča svojo sposobnost uporabe osnovnega matematičnega razmišljanja in vnaprej usposobljenega znanja. Medtem ko kaže zmanjšano učinkovitost pri zapletenih nastavitvah nalog, še vedno prekaša CRT v relativnem smislu. Predlagani okvir in moduli DUT, uporabljeni v naših poskusih, bodo po objavi odprtokodni.«

Najdi tehnični papir tukaj. Izdano oktober 2023 (prednatis).

Zhang, Zixi, Greg Chadwick, Hugo McNally, Yiren Zhao in Robert Mullins. "LLM4DV: Uporaba velikih jezikovnih modelov za generiranje dražljajev za testiranje strojne opreme." arXiv prednatis arXiv:2310.04535 (2023).

Sorodno branje
Testni izzivi naraščajo, ko se zahteve po zanesljivosti povečujejo
Novi pristopi, od umetne inteligence do telemetrije, presegajo donos.
AI, naraščajoča kompleksnost čipov zapleta izdelavo prototipov
Nenehne posodobitve, več spremenljivk in nove zahteve glede zmogljivosti na vat spodbujajo spremembe na sprednji strani zasnove.

Časovni žig:

Več od Semi Engineering